THE rise in Rodney Brondial’s numbers is no joke.
After averaging just 1.0 points and 1.13 rebounds in eight games during the Commissioner’s Cup, San Miguel's resident funnyman is now producing 6.7 rebounds and 10.29 rebounds through seven games in the Philippine Cup.
The former Adamson big man had 16 points and a career-high 22 rebounds in San Miguel’s 128-89 win over Terrafirma on Sunday at the Ynares Center-Montalban, proving that his increased production over the course of the conference is no fluke.

The 34-year-old Brondial said he is taking advantage of the minutes given to him now that the tournament is an all-local conference.
“Siyempre, all-Filipino. Eto siyempre ‘yung pagkakataon natin na maglaro eh. Pag may import, nasa mundo na naman tayo ng mga halimaw eh,” said Brondial in jest.
“Pag may import, pa-joke time joke time na naman tayo,” said Brondial, who also became known for his comic skits on social media concerning his seaman friend.
Sunday’s performance wasn’t the first time this conference that he had a double-double.
In their game against Magnolia last April 16, Brondial scored 10 points and hauled down 11 rebounds. But he insisted that his focus is mainly rebounding, which could be the reason why he grabbed nine twice and eight twice this conference.
“Ako naman, kung ano ‘yung mabibigay ko especially ‘yung mga intangibles. Basta makatulong lang sa team. Hindi naman ako conscious sa points. Ever since naman, ‘yung rebounds talaga ang focus ko saka ‘yung depensa.
“Nagkataon lang ‘yung 16 points talaga. Mas binibilang ko pa nga ‘yung rebounds,” said Brondial.

San Miguel coach Leo Austria isn’t surprised with the fine play of Brondial, his player way back during his Adamson days after spotting him in a village league.
“Ever since naman eh, alam naman natin ‘yung kanyang hard-nosed defense at ‘yung kanyang rebounding. He is intense. During practice, makikita mo ‘yung intensity, nandoon eh. That’s the habit na ginagawa niya.”
“When we won the all-Filipino, nag-20-20 din siya against Blackwater sa playoffs kaya ‘yun ‘yung mga ginagawa niya. I’m so fortunate to have a player like him. Hindi mo na kailangang i-motivate. Self-motivated siya,” said Austria.
